Food safety authorities of all importing countries including the EU, the US have put in
place stringent laws and lowered the tolerance limits of contaminants like antibiotics
causing substantial increase in cargo rejection from many countries.
A single rejection distorts the rotation of working capital and huge losses happen due
to destruction of cargo. In this context we, with support of the Government of India -
Ministry Of Finance, IRDA & RBI and in Association with Amlin corperate Insurance
and Marsh Inc, have launched an Insurance scheme to support the Indian exporter
in the event of unfortunate rejection by health authorities of the EU, the US
and Canada.
